Chemoreceptors
Sensory receptor cells or organs that transduce (convert) chemical substances in the environment or blood into signals perceived by the nervous system.
Carbon Dioxide
An invisible, scent-free gas generated through the combustion of carbon-based materials and in the act of respiration. It exists naturally within the Earth's atmosphere and is utilized by plants during photosynthesis.
Oxygen
A chemical element with symbol O, essential for cellular respiration in aerobic organisms and a component of the Earth's atmosphere.
Surfactant
A substance that reduces the surface tension of a liquid, aiding in processes such as lung function and cleaning.
